FIRST POSTNET STORE JOINS FORCES WITH THE GROWING MBE FRANCHISE NETWORK IN AUSTRALIA

-

Mail Boxes Etc (MBE) is proud to announce the first PostNet store to join forces, rebrand and become part of the larger more successful MBE network.

This news comes after the closure of PostNet Australia where existing franchisee­s have been given the opportunit­y to convert to an MBE store.

PostNet Broadway in Sydney, has now transition­ed into MBE Broadway and is open for business. With the current conditions surroundin­g the Covid-19 pandemic, MBE has been officially labeled an essential business providing B2B and C2B logistics across Australia and around the world.

Clayton Treloar, CEO of MBE Australia said, “MBE is part of a large group of 2,500 locations around the world and with the recent closure of PostNet Australia, each PostNet franchisee had the opportunit­y to come on board at very little or no cost”

“This is an excellent pathway for PostNet franchisee­s that enables them to rebrand and continue running their business. The owners of PostNet Broadway are extremely excited to be part of MBE and they’re really looking forward to the future.”

Now sitting at 40 locations Australia-wide with the opening of the newest location in North Sydney last month, MBE is looking to add up to 80 more centres across the country bringing the total to 120 within 5 years.

Treloar added “With the huge increase in pack and ship business across all centres, we are truly a multi revenue business bringing together printing, shipping and mailbox rental to form our business service centre.

It’s like running three businesses in one, which makes for a profitable little business”.
